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import serial
- import time
- ser = serial.Serial('COM3', 9600)
- d=0.2
- de=0.1
- hell=1000
- def led(channel,r=0,g=0,b=0):
- erg="~%s%s%s#~%s%s%s#~%s%s%s#"%(3*channel,"%",r,3*channel+1,"%",g,3*channel+2,"%",b)
- ser.write(erg)
- while 1:
- led(1,0,0,0)
- led(2,0,0,0)
- led(3,0,0,0)
- led(4,0,0,0)
- led(0,hell)
- time.sleep(d)
- led(0,0)
- led(1,0,hell)
- time.sleep(d)
- led(1,0,0)
- led(2,0,0,hell)
- time.sleep(d)
- led(2,0,0,0)
- led(3,hell)
- time.sleep(d)
- led(3,0)
- led(4,0,hell)
- time.sleep(d)
- led(0,hell)
- time.sleep(de)
- led(1,hell)
- time.sleep(de)
- led(2,hell)
- time.sleep(de)
- led(3,hell)
- time.sleep(de)
- led(4,hell)
- time.sleep(d)
- led(0,0,hell)
- time.sleep(de)
- led(1,0,hell)
- time.sleep(de)
- led(2,0,hell)
- time.sleep(de)
- led(3,0,hell)
- time.sleep(de)
- led(4,0,hell)
- time.sleep(d)
- led(0,0,0,hell)
- time.sleep(de)
- led(1,0,0,hell)
- time.sleep(de)
- led(2,0,0,hell)
- time.sleep(de)
- led(3,0,0,hell)
- time.sleep(de)
- led(4,0,0,hell)
- time.sleep(d)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ement